The Scientific Principles Behind Temperature and Bed Bug Elimination
Comprehending the relationship between temperature and bed bug elimination is key to grasping the efficacy of heat treatment. Bed bugs, scientifically known as Cimex lectularius, are affected by temperature extremes. Studies show that contact with temperatures above 118°F (48°C) for a sustained period can successfully eliminate bed bugs in each developmental phase, including eggs. Conversely, temperatures below 50°F (10°C) can more information increase their longevity, enabling them to reach a dormant state.
The fatal influence of heat on bed bugs is attributed to its effect on their biological processes. Elevated heat levels compromise cellular activity and result in dehydration, finally causing mortality. Moreover, heat treatment permeates different surfaces, ensuring that hidden infestations are addressed. The success of this technique is rooted in its ability to achieve uniform temperatures throughout infested spaces, removing the bugs without employing chemical solutions, making it a preferred option for many pest control professionals.

Bed Bug Life Cycle
The efficiency of thermal treatment against bed bugs is closely linked to their life cycle. Bed bugs experience several stages: egg, nymph, and adult. Eggs are notably fragile, as they cannot withstand high temperatures. Once hatched, nymphs and adults are also susceptible; however, they can endure lower temperatures for brief periods. Heat treatment raises the temperature to thresholds fatal for all life stages, interrupting their life cycle. At 118°F (48°C), bed bugs begin to die within 90 minutes, while temperatures above 122°F (50°C) can eliminate them within minutes. This comprehensive approach guarantees that not only adult bed bugs are eliminated, but also their eggs and nymphs, making heat treatment a proven method for total elimination.
Chemical Resistance Constraints
Numerous pest control professionals are progressively concerned about the growing chemical resistance of bed bugs. Traditional insecticides, once reliable, are continually failing due to adaptive mechanisms in bed bug populations. These pests can develop resistance through genetic mutations, making it challenging for chemical treatments to eradicate infestations completely. As a result, relying solely on chemicals can cause prolonged infestations and greater costs for homeowners. In contrast, heat treatment bypasses this issue by attacking bed bugs with high temperatures that they are unable to survive. At temperatures above 120°F, bed bugs, including nymphs and eggs, are rapidly exterminated within minutes. This method not only guarantees thorough extermination but also eliminates the risk of resistance, making heat treatment an effective solution for bed bug infestations.

Duration Of The Treatment Procedure
How long can one expect the heat treatment for bed bugs to last? In most cases, the treatment can range from six to eight hours, according to the scope of the infested space and the intensity of the infestation. Throughout this period, a temperature range of 120°F to 140°F is sustained to ensure the complete eradication of bed bugs at every life stage. Homeowners should be prepared for the entire space to heat up, which may require removing sensitive items beforehand. Once the treatment is complete, a cooling period will ensue, enabling the area to settle back to a safe and normal temperature. It is essential for occupants to vacate the premises as instructed to achieve ideal results and safety throughout the process.

Critical Steps to Take Before Heat Treatment
Planning for bed bug heat treatment demands careful planning to ensure optimal results and safety. Residents should start by removing items from the treatment area, including linens, clothing, and personal belongings, to protect items and guarantee thorough heating. It is essential to clean and dry these items on maximum heat to eradicate any lurking bed bugs.
Furthermore, furniture needs to be shifted away from walls to permit free heat circulation. Furthermore, sensitive electronics, plants, and perishable goods must be moved to avoid exposure to high temperatures. Pets must be taken to a safe environment during treatment, as they may be negatively impacted.
In conclusion, staying in contact with the pest control specialist is essential for grasping the customized guidelines specific to your circumstances. Adhering to these measures will help maximize the effectiveness of the heat treatment process, promising a residence that is entirely rid of bed bugs.
